Ticket: Staging env misconfigured for Siftgate bloom filter

The bloom layer in front of the Pellet KV store is rejecting all lookups in staging because the env file was copied from the dev template without credentials. False-positive tuning values are fine; only the auth line is missing. To unblock the weekly demo, the Pellet admission secret must be set on the following line.

env line for yaguf-fajop: LEDGER_TOKEN13=fb08984397349

The Haulstone pick-list optimizer is owned by the Fulfillment Systems group. Route planning logic lives in the `haulstone-core` repo; the nightly re-optimization job is operated by the Warehouse Platform rotation. For the weekly eng sync, note that algorithm changes go through Dena Kivuli's review queue, while deployment and incident questions belong to the platform rotation. Performance regressions in the Marwick depot pilot should be raised within one business day. For all optimizer questions, use the team address below.

alerts address for bajop-yahog: istwyn@lumiclabs.internal

Subject: Ownership change — GrowCell drift compensation

As discussed, responsibility for the sensor-drift compensation module in the GrowCell greenhouse controller is moving to a new owner this cycle. The module currently applies a rolling baseline correction to humidity and CO2 readings; the open review covers the switch to a Kalman-style estimator and the recalibration schedule for the Bay 3 test rig. Please route review comments, drift-threshold questions, and any anomaly reports from the pilot greenhouses to the engineer named below.

account owner for fajep-yagef: Kasix Eliiel

Handover: user module split

Hey, welcome aboard! I'm handing off the user-module extraction from the Lanternfish monolith. Short version: auth and profiles now live in their own service (userbase-svc), while the monolith keeps a thin shim that proxies calls. The shim logs every proxied request, so you can watch traffic drain as we migrate callers. Don't delete the old tables yet — billing still joins against them. Quirks are in the wiki. The new service boots with this configuration:

config for yajep-tafof:
[rusath]
team = julmir
access_code = ac_fe37fd
host = rusath.novactech.test
port = 8000
owner = pelmir.weneth
peer = oliwyn.olvarqdyn.internal